Information requirementsMaster data on the investment fundsPrior to the first date of inclusion in the SP Option Scheme, the investment funds are to submit a number of master data on the registered investment funds to Morningstar. The investment funds are obliged to update these master data continually if the data are changed. The investment funds are also to submit historic, daily net asset values to Morningstar. Information to be submitted annuallyInformation on Total Costs, securities trading, trade-related depositary costs and commission costs is to be submitted to Morningstar no later than on 31 January. If based on financial data, the information is, however, to be submitted no later than 5 days after the publication of the annual report, cf Appendix 5 to the Cooperation Agreement. Quarterly information requirements The investment fund is to submit an updated portfolio survey to Morningstar on a quarterly basis no later than at the end of the first month of the following quarter.
